High pressure is in place and will stick around for several days.  This will lead to mostly sunny to sunny skies, some the warmest temperatures we have seen in quite some time and mainly dry conditions.  Today and the start of the weekend will be on the dry side, but Sunday does hold a chance for a few scattered showers in the northern third of the state.  The high mountain peaks there could see a rain/snow mix.  Temperatures will be very mild and top off in the 60s and 70s, with 50s for the high country.
